Output 345574598cada506d51587c8b672af4dc86bc9d494eeb664a2cacb106b5a4483:17

value
2100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e7dcf86afc17c7bd1a9803d90df6832e677bec71 OP_EQUAL
address
ADaFTzbjkdQ9hNXUq2hj11oyZECv1Hxz6C
transaction
345574598cada506d51587c8b672af4dc86bc9d494eeb664a2cacb106b5a4483